Acne scarring develops when the skin’s normal healing process is disrupted by deeper or prolonged inflammation. Like all acne, it begins with excess sebum production, abnormal shedding of skin cells, clogged pores, and microbial activity داخل the follicle. When inflammation becomes intense or extends beyond the سطح layers of the skin, it can damage the surrounding tissue and alter how the skin repairs itself. This is what distinguishes acne that heals cleanly from acne that leaves behind permanent textural changes.
The depth of the acne lesion is one of the most important factors. Superficial lesions such as blackheads and small whiteheads usually remain confined to the upper layers of the skin, where healing occurs relatively quickly and without structural damage. In contrast, deeper lesions مثل nodules and cysts involve the dermis, where collagen and connective tissue provide structural support. When inflammation reaches this level, it can break down these structures, making full restoration more difficult.
A key event in scar formation is the rupture of the follicular wall. As pressure builds داخل a clogged pore, the wall may weaken and break, allowing oil, bacteria, and cellular debris to spread into surrounding tissue. This triggers a stronger immune response, which can damage nearby collagen fibers. The more extensive this damage, the higher the likelihood that the skin will not return to its original structure after healing.
Collagen plays a central role in how scars form. During the repair process, the skin attempts to rebuild damaged tissue by producing new collagen. If too little collagen is produced, it can lead to atrophic scars, which appear as depressions or indentations in the skin. If too much collagen is formed, raised scars may develop. The balance of collagen production is influenced by the شدت and duration of inflammation, as well as individual healing responses.
The length of time that inflammation persists also affects scarring risk. Acne lesions that remain active for extended periods continue to stimulate the immune system, increasing the فرصة of tissue damage. Repeated breakouts in the same area can further weaken the skin’s structure, compounding the effects over time. This is why early and consistent management of inflammatory acne is often emphasized to reduce long-term آثار.
External factors can also contribute to scar formation. Manipulating lesions through picking or squeezing can increase inflammation and push debris deeper into the skin, worsening tissue damage. In addition, inadequate skincare or the use of overly harsh products may compromise the skin barrier, making it more vulnerable to prolonged inflammation and impaired healing.
Individual differences in skin biology also play a role. Genetic factors can influence how the skin responds to inflammation and how collagen is produced during healing. Some individuals may be more prone to developing scars even with moderate acne, while others may heal with minimal lasting changes despite more severe breakouts.
Because acne scarring results from a combination of depth, inflammation, and healing response, prevention is a key focus in dermatology. Treatments that reduce inflammation, regulate oil production, and prevent clogged pores can help limit the conditions that lead to tissue damage. For individuals experiencing persistent or severe acne, professional evaluation is often recommended to reduce the risk of scarring and support more controlled healing. While not all acne leads to scars, understanding why scarring occurs highlights the importance of early, consistent, and appropriate management.
